Correction: Oak Replaces Co-Manager on Black Oak E

X
Your article was successfully shared with the contacts you provided.

Aug. 1, 2002 — Oak Associates, known for its aggressive tech-oriented mutual funds, replaced Thomas Hipp as a co-manager on Black Oak Emerging Technology Fund (BOGSX).

Jeffrey Travis, an analyst at Oak, will co-manage the portfolio with existing co-manager Jim Oelschlager, founder of the firm.

An earlier article incorrectly reported that Jim Travis was named as co-manager.
